Видео по теме

КАК СДЕЛАТЬ КНОПКУ СКАЧИВАНИЯ В HTML? #html #css #js #javascript #frontend #фронтенд

[Курс] JavaScript для маленьких и тупых. Урок #1

Введение в удаление элементов с помощью JavaScript

JavaScript предоставляет множество возможностей для работы с данными. Одной из распространенных задач является удаление элементов из массивов и объектов. В этом руководстве мы рассмотрим различные способы, как вы можете использовать JavaScript для удаления элементов, а также приведем полезные примеры.

Удаление элементов из массивов

Существует несколько методов для удаления элементов из массивов в JavaScript. Рассмотрим некоторые из них:

  • Метод splice() - используется для удаления элементов по индексу. Он изменяет оригинальный массив и возвращает удаленные элементы.
  • Метод filter() - позволяет создать новый массив, исключая элементы, которые не соответствуют заданному условию.
  • Метод pop() - удаляет последний элемент массива. Если вам нужно удалить именно последний элемент, это наиболее простой способ.
  • Метод shift() - удаляет первый элемент массива. Это полезно, когда важно работать с данными в порядке их поступления.

Примеры удаления из массивов

Рассмотрим несколько примеров использования этих методов:

const numbers = [1, 2, 3, 4, 5]; // Удаляем элемент по индексу numbers.splice(2, 1); // Удаляет "3" console.log(numbers); // [1, 2, 4, 5] // Создаем новый массив без элемента 2 const newNumbers = numbers.filter(num => num !== 2); console.log(newNumbers); // [1, 4, 5]

Удаление свойств из объектов

В JavaScript вы также можете удалять свойства из объектов с помощью оператора delete. Это позволяет вам динамически управлять данными.

  • Оператор delete - удаляет свойство из объекта. Если свойство существует, оно будет удалено, а если нет - никаких изменений не произойдет.

Пример удаления свойства из объекта

const user = { name: 'Alice', age: 25, city: 'New York' }; // Удаляем свойство 'city' delete user.city; console.log(user); // { name: 'Alice', age: 25 }

Заключение

Использование JavaScript для удаления элементов из массивов и объектов может значительно упростить вашу работу с данными. Применяя методы, такие как splice(), filter() и оператор delete, вы сможете эффективно управлять своими данными. Надеемся, что это руководство помогло вам лучше понять, как использовать javascript delete в ваших проектах.

Похожие записи

Рекомендации

Чувствую себя на работе никем? Найдите вдохновение и уверенность!
Чувствую себя на работе никем? Найдите вдохновение и уверенность! Если вы чувствуете себя на работе никем, это нормально. Найдите вдохновение и уверенность, чтобы изменить ситуацию, развивая свои навыки, устанавливая связи и принимая активное участие в команде.
Скачайте Office Home через торрент - легкий доступ к мощным офисным инструментам!
Скачайте Office Home через торрент - легкий доступ к мощным офисным инструментам! Скачайте Office Home через торрент и получите доступ к мощным офисным инструментам для работы и учебы. Удобный интерфейс и широкий функционал помогут вам эффективно решать любые задачи.
WooCommerce: Как установить и настроить цены для увеличения продаж
WooCommerce: Как установить и настроить цены для увеличения продаж Узнайте, как эффективно установить и настроить цены в WooCommerce для увеличения продаж. Этот гид поможет вам оптимизировать ценовые стратегии и привлечь больше клиентов в ваш интернет-магазин.
Как эффективно продать себя на работу: советы и стратегии успеха
Как эффективно продать себя на работу: советы и стратегии успеха В статье рассматриваются эффективные стратегии и советы, как продать себя на работу, включая создание впечатляющего резюме, подготовку к собеседованию и развитие личного бренда для достижения карьерных целей.
Купите лучшие баскетбольные кроссовки на лендингах – стиль и комфорт для вашей игры!
Купите лучшие баскетбольные кроссовки на лендингах – стиль и комфорт для вашей игры! Ищете идеальные баскетбольные кроссовки? Наши лендинги предлагают стильные и комфортные модели, которые улучшат вашу игру. Выберите лучшие варианты и заберите свою победу на корте!

Постарайтесь Указать Свои

Постарайтесь указать все свои навыки, опыт работы и образование. А в некоторых случаях нарушителю грозит лишение свободы. Как оптимизировать постоянные ссылки в Wordpress. Ведь эти люди наполняют сайты интересным и уникальным материалом. Также он имеет модуль транслитерации заголовков и файлов, добавления уведомления об использовании Cookie, опции для настройки 301 редиректов и прочие полезные инструменты, которые зачастую приходится устанавливать отдельными плагинами. Некоторые сервисы отлично подходят для создания лендингов, другие – для интернет-магазинов. Это реальная возможность получать вещи бесплатно и создавать контент без вложений. Загружайте изображения нужного размера Если вы планируете вставить на сайт картинку шириной 800 пикселей, не стоит загружать туда изображение 4000×3000. Создание аккаунтов в соцсетях. Биржа работает как посредник и следит за тем, чтобы стороны выполняли свои обязательства. javascript delete

Лендинг Пейдж Landing

Лендинг-пейдж (Landing Page) — это целевая страница, разработанная для выполнения одной ключевой задачи: привлечения клиентов, увеличения продаж или генерации заявок. Количество заказчиков : несколько тысяч, точное число не раскрывается. Кэширование помогает ускорить загрузку страниц за счёт сохранения копий страниц или их частей на сервере или промежуточном узле сети. Включает функцию кэширования в браузере. Вышеприведенный код работает только под Apache при наличии модуля mod_rewrite и значении директивы AllowOverride отличном от None. (директива «AllowOverride None» может быть выставлена как для сервера в целом, так и для конкретного сайта, нужно проверить все места). Фрилансеры находятся в зоне риска потери здоровья больше, чем другие люди. Они должны самостоятельно решать финансовые, налоговые и юридические вопросы, что требует дополнительных знаний и времени. 4. Он всегда борется за справедливость и за то, чтобы предоставить всё, что пообещали, сделать это в срок и качественно. WP Login Lockdown — бесплатный WordPress плагин, который повышает безопасность вашей страницы входа. От этого зависит, сможет ли он работать в приложениях, которыми пользуются в компании. javascript delete

Настройка Способов Оплаты

Настройка способов оплаты. Грамотная композиция элементов завершает процесс создания дизайна. Разместите в меню те ссылки, которые должны быть всегда под рукой. Важно понимать, что создание интернет-магазина на WordPress требует определенных знаний и навыков. Без сомнения, вы можете цитировать другие сайты, но копирование всей страницы приведет вас к беде. Каждый из них имеет свои особенности и преимущества, поэтому важно выбрать наиболее подходящий вариант. Вносите изменения и публикуете. Иерархия в дизайне. Зайдите в медифайлы в админке, там появится новый раздел Bulk optimization, тут можно с помощью массовой оптимизации обновить хоть 100 изображений за раз. Репутация. javascript delete

Удаленная Дистанционная Работа

Удаленная, или дистанционная работа, становится все более популярной среди соискателей. Оно способно заменить сразу несколько плагинов из этой подборки, рассмотренных ниже. Это повысит вашу репутацию. Выберите раздел «Создать БД» в левой колонке. SSL-сертификат — зачем нужен и где получить. Сложности в адаптации новых сотрудников . Регулярно подписывайтесь на новых блогеров, чтобы расширять свой «инфлюенсерский кругозор», уделяйте время чтению новостей и светской хроники, чтобы понимать, с кем из селебрити стоит работать, а кто уже ввязался в скандал и не подойдёт вам. Помните, нет идеального решения. Облегчить процесс оплаты и сделать его более удобным можно, например, подключив популярный сервис приёма онлайн-платежей ЮКаssa ; CRM-маркетинга . Мы не включали в подборку образовательные программы по аналитике и data science — только классическое программирование.